I have APC Matrix UPS 5KVA,configuration is as follows
4 phoenix XP165 batteries (120AH)
Sp Gr between 1240 -1260 in all cells.
Charging cutoff voltage 56 volts (14v each battery)
Low cutoff voltage 42 volts (10.5 volts each battery)
Charging about 10 amps, trickle charge less than 1 amp
Load varies between 300 to 1000 watts
No problem with backup time ( up to 4 to 5 hours tested, never had cutoff due to low battery)
Output voltage 220 volts fixed all the time on battery backup
My question is that my batteries are 6 months old, have electrolyte from the shop (most probably prepared by tap water) although I always top it up with distilled water, i want to replace the electrolyte with pyro one, should i perform the flush or directly replace the electrolyte after draining the old one?
